Aloe Vera Extract: Nature's Gift for Health and Beauty
Aloe vera extract, derived from the succulent leaves of the Aloe vera plant, has been revered for centuries for its multifaceted therapeutic and cosmetic properties. This perennial plant, native to arid regions of Africa and now cultivated globally, produces a gel-like substance within its fleshy leaves that forms the basis of this potent extract. The extraction process involves carefully removing the inner leaf gel, which is then processed to concentrate its beneficial components while preserving its natural integrity.
The chemical composition of aloe vera extract is remarkably complex, containing over 200 active constituents. These include vitamins (A, C, E, B12, folic acid), minerals (calcium, magnesium, zinc), enzymes (amylase, bradykininase), amino acids (18 of the 20 essential ones), and most importantly, polysaccharides such as acemannan. These polysaccharides are primarily responsible for many of the extract's medicinal properties, including its immunomodulatory effects.
Medicinally, aloe vera extract demonstrates impressive therapeutic potential. Its anti-inflammatory properties make it effective for treating burns, wounds, and skin irritations. The extract promotes wound healing by stimulating fibroblast activity, which aids in collagen production and tissue regeneration. For digestive health, it acts as a gentle laxative due to anthraquinone compounds like aloin, though modern processing often removes these to create safer products. Recent research suggests potential benefits in managing diabetes through its hypoglycemic effects, though clinical applications require further study.
In dermatology and cosmetics, aloe vera extract is prized for its hydrating and soothing properties. Its ability to increase skin elasticity and moisture content makes it an excellent ingredient for moisturizers, creams, and lotions.
